First Impressions & Unboxing
Pulling the RIVER 2 out of its packaging, the first detail that stands out is just how compact it is. Measuring only 9.6 x 8.5 x 5.7 inches, it feels no larger than an industrial-grade lunchbox. The external chassis consists of a rigid, matte-gray polycarbonate plastic that feels solid, though it does tend to pick up minor surface scratches easily if set down on gravel or concrete.
Unlike older generations, the handle on this unit is integrated into the back of the device rather than the top. While this makes carrying the 7.7-pound unit feel balanced and comfortable, it does create a small protrusion on the rear that prevents the unit from being pushed entirely flush against walls. On the positive side, the top surface is now completely flat, making it easier to stack other light gear on top in a crowded car trunk.
Turning on the front display reveals a bright, legible LCD screen that displays your remaining battery percentage, real-time input and output wattages, and a calculated countdown of remaining runtime. It is responsive, highly visible in direct sunlight, and doesn't suffer from the sluggish refresh rates common in budget-tier power stations.

Key Specifications
| Specification | Detail |
|---|---|
| Battery Capacity | 256Wh (20Ah 12.8V) |
| Battery Chemistry | LiFePO4 (LFP) |
| Cycle Life | 3,000+ cycles to 80% capacity (~10 years use) |
| AC Inverter Output | 300W continuous (600W Surge / X-Boost) |
| Wall Charging Time | 60 minutes (0% to 100% via 360W X-Stream) |

Performance Tests: Math vs. Reality
1. The CPAP & Laptop Field Office Test
To evaluate the device as an emergency medical or remote work backup, we tested its efficiency under low-to-moderate continuous loads. Our calculations utilize the standard battery efficiency equation:
Runtime = (Capacity × 0.85 Inverter Efficiency) ÷ Appliance Wattage
For a standard CPAP machine drawing an average of 30W (with the heated humidifier and heated tube turned completely off), the math predicts a runtime of 7.25 hours. In our physical test, the RIVER 2 successfully powered the machine for 7 hours and 12 minutes before the automatic low-voltage cutoff kicked in to protect the cells.
When running a standard 60W laptop charger, the calculation predicts 3.6 hours of continuous power. Our real-world test matched this almost perfectly, providing exactly 3.5 hours of battery life, making it a reliable choice for remote workers looking to survive a full afternoon off-grid.
2. The Car Fridge Test (Math vs. Reality)
Next, we ran a long-term test using a 12V portable compressor car fridge set to 36°F in a room ambient temperature of 75°F. On a standard DC connection, the fridge draws an average of 45W during its active cooling compressor cycles.
Applying our formula, we estimated a theoretical runtime of 4.8 hours. Because portable fridges cycle their compressors on and off, the real-world draw is not completely continuous. Under these cycling conditions, the RIVER 2 kept the fridge safely cold for 6.5 hours.
While this is fine for an afternoon picnic or tailgating session, it is not enough to sustain food storage overnight. If you plan on running a portable fridge for multi-day camping trips, you will definitely need to pair the unit with an external solar panel to top it off during daylight hours.
3. The X-Boost Challenge & Fan Noise Test
One of the most misunderstood aspects of the RIVER 2 is EcoFlow’s proprietary X-Boost technology. The physical AC inverter inside the unit is rated for 300W continuous output. When you plug in a device that demands more power (up to 600W), X-Boost does not magically output 600W of clean energy. Instead, it intentionally drops the voltage output to prevent the inverter from overloading, allowing the device to run at a lower heat and speed.
This trick works fine for simple resistive heating elements, such as a basic travel hairdryer or a small personal heating pad. However, if you plug in sensitive electronic devices, electronic coffee grinders, or heavy-draw inductive tools (like a 1200W microwave), the inverter will instantly trigger an overload shutdown to protect its circuitry.
During our wall-charging test, we monitored the internal cooling fans. When drawing its maximum 360W from the grid, the fan kicked on immediately, generating a steady 45 dB hum. It is comparable to the fan noise of a high-performance gaming laptop under heavy load—audible in a quiet room, but quiet enough to be easily ignored if placed across the room.

Comparison with Top Competitors
| Feature | EcoFlow RIVER 2 | Bluetti EB3A | Jackery 300 Plus |
|---|---|---|---|
| Capacity | 256Wh | 268Wh | 288Wh |
| Chemistry | LiFePO4 | LiFePO4 | LiFePO4 |
| AC Output | 300W continuous | 600W continuous | 300W continuous |
| AC Charge Time | 60 mins | 70 mins | 120 mins |
| Weight | 7.7 lbs | 10.1 lbs | 11.0 lbs |
Mobile Reader Takeaways:
- Weight Winner: The EcoFlow RIVER 2 is significantly lighter than both options at only 7.7 lbs.
- Charging Speed Winner: The RIVER 2 edges out the competition with a lightning-fast 60-minute wall recharge.
- Output Winner: The Bluetti EB3A provides a stronger 600W continuous AC inverter out of the box, making it better for slightly heavier appliances.
